5. An element consisting of hydrogen and calomel electrodes is used to measure the pH of a solution on a mountain where the atmospheric pressure is 500 mmHg. Hydrogen bubbles through the electrode and is released as bubbles at a pressure that matches the ambient pressure. If the calculated pH value is 4, what is the true pH value of the solution?
